Ngāti Whātua Ōrākei Matariki Planting Day
Ngāti Whātua Ōrākei is welcoming people from across Tāmaki Makaurau and beyond to come together for its annual Matariki Planting Day on Saturday 20 June.

The planting day is part of Matariki Herenga Waka, a city-wide celebration of the Māori New Year grounded in mātauranga Māori and open to everyone. The programme brings together cultural experiences, contemporary creativity, community connection and opportunities for reflection throughout June and July. 

“Our annual Matariki Planting Day is about people coming together, connecting with the whenua and giving back to the taiao. It is a hands-on way for everyone, from tamariki through to kaumātua, to take part in Matariki and contribute to the restoration and care of Takaparawhau,” says organiser, Levi Watene.

Held at Te Pou Whakairo, 59B Kitemoana Street, Ōrākei, the annual Matariki Planting Day is a special opportunity for everyone in Tāmaki to come together and give back to whenua during the Matariki season.

This year, around 3000 native plants will be planted on Takaparawhau, Bastion Point, helping to restore and nurture the taiao. Tamariki, rangatahi, pakeke and kaumātua are all welcome to take part in this hands-on day for all ages.
